Orleans Finance Committee split on high school support

The committee narrowly voted in favor of the project by a 4-3-1 vote.  Committee Chairwoman Lynn Bruneau, Vice Chairwoman Elaine Baird and members Nicholas Athanassiou and Roger Pearson voted to support the project. Members Robert Renn, Edmund Mahoney and Russell Lavoie voted against the project, and Timothy Counihan chose to abstain. Those who voted in favor of the project cited the need for repairs and renovations at the nearly 50-year old school building; the laborious planning already done by the School Building Committee, architects and civil engineers; and the assurance of $36 million in state aid for the project, which can be claimed if the project is approved by May 31.

The $131.8 million Nauset high school project goes before voters March 30

ORLEANS  A joint meeting addressed a range of issues Wednesday about the $131.8 million high school project in the lead-up to a districtwide vote March 30. Two questions will go before voters: Will they support the Nauset Regional High School building project and the debt it will incur? And will they approve a debt override to pay for it? If the school project passes and the debt question fails, Orleans will have a $1 million budget deficit, Town Administrator John Kelly said during the meeting between the Nauset Regional School Committee, Select Board and Finance Committee. “Hopefully, voters understand that if they vote in favor of the project, they need to vote yes on both,” he said. “This is not like a Town Meeting vote that’s contingent on a debt exclusion question passing. The debt exclusion and school project must pass on their own merits.”

An early morning fire killed a person in Grove City

A fire in the heart of Grove City has claimed a life early Thursday morning. Just before 3 a.m., Jackson Township firefighters were called to the 2700 block of Independence Way, near Hoover and Home roads, arriving just as flames were shooting through the roof, said Lynn Bruno, spokesman for the department. As firefighters worked to battle the fire, they found one victim in the kitchen. The victim was pronounced dead at the scene. The Franklin County Coroner s office didn t immediately return calls for the victim s name. No information has been released about the victim or cause of the fire. It was unclear if the home had working smoke detectors, Bruno said.
